Phillips, one of the more moderate members of the House Democratic caucus, has consistently called for aging politicians to move on from public life — many of them from his own party. For more than a year, he has said that President Joe Biden should not run for reelection, and he has also called for Sen. Dianne Feinstein (D-Calif.) to resign as she faces questions over her capacity to serve. He has also said Senate Minority Leader Mitch McConnell should step down.
Elected to the House in 2018, Phillips considered running against Biden in the Democratic presidential primary until recently and called on others to step into the race.
